Spinach Artichoke Cups
These spinach artichoke cups combine a crunchy wonton cup with a creamy spinach artichoke dip filling! The perfect party food or finger food for a dinner party!

Ingredients
48
wonton wrappers
¼
cup
mayo
⅓
cup
shredded Parmesan cheese
¼
cup
plain Greek yogurt
1
cup
frozen chopped spinach
thawed and drained
15
oz
canned or jarred artichokes
not marinated
6
oz
cream cheese
¼
tsp
garlic powder
¼
tsp
kosher salt
Instructions
For the Cups
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ees.
Spray mini muffin tins with a non-stick baking spray.
Press a wonton wrapper into each of the baking cups with your fingers to create a cup.
Bake for 7-8 minutes or until they are lightly browned and crispy.
Remove muffin cups from the tin and let cool on a cooling rack.
Fill cooled cups with spinach artichoke dip filling and serve warm.
For the Spinach Dip Filling
Heat up the cream cheese in a microwave safe bowl for one minute or until soft.
Mix the mayo, yogurt, garlic powder, and salt into the cream cheese.
Add in the chopped spinach, artichokes, and Parmesan cheese. Stir until well combined.
